Whether your office needs a copier, your home needs a plumber, or a friend needs a trusted professional, the introduction can create real tuition support.
Describe the need naturally. NedyV finds the right category and asks useful follow-up questions.
Relevant Oholei Torah businesses appear first; the wider NedyV network fills any gaps.
Share the contact person and everything you know, then follow the referral’s progress.
Local matches send 100% to the chosen beneficiary. If the network fills a gap, 80% goes there and 20% supports the provider’s school.
A stronger parent economy
Anyone can find a trusted provider. A community business earns revenue. The resulting contribution helps a selected family with tuition. Invite links let every member bring more people into the cycle, and everyone can see the progress.
Search, refer, choose your own child or another beneficiary, invite others, and follow every introduction to credit.
Choose the promise, receive qualified opportunities and contribution documentation, with a potential tax benefit when eligible.
Approve participating businesses and reconcile contributions to the correct family ledger.
The provider chooses a visible contribution promise before the introduction is shared. Local matches send 100% to the selected beneficiary; cross-school fallback matches send 80% there and 20% to the provider’s school. Members see the status, providers report progress, and each school confirms its allocation.
